Kezdőoldal » Számítástechnika » Programozás » Létre lehet hozni PDF vagy...

Létre lehet hozni PDF vagy Word fájlt C# WPF-ben?

Figyelt kérdés
Tegyük fel, hogy készítettem egy lebutított szövegszerkesztőt. Eddig rendben van, de létezik valamilyen library aminek segítségével PDF vagy Word dokumentumba át tudom exportálni a bevitt illetve megformázott szöveget?

2020. nov. 11. 23:05
1 2 3 4 5
 11/43 anonim ***** válasza:

Ennyire futotta? Három sor szöveg, az is gyér karakterkódolással meg pár egyenes vonal? Nyilván túloztam a 400 oldallal, de minimum 2-3 oldalt azért elvártam volna. Úgy tűnik magadtól nem tudod hogy néz ki egy szokásos dokumentum.

- Fej-, és lábléc amely tartalmazza a dokumentum megnevezését, a szerző nevét, illetve oldalszámozást. Hogy melyiket hova helyezed, rád hagyom.

- Tartalom, ami tőlem lehet lorem ipsum is negyven oldalon át, de legyen részekre bontva amik minimum egy szintes hierarchiát alkotnak. Az egyes fejezeteken belül a szövegblokkok legyenek bekezdésekre bontva

- A dokumentum egészére vonatkozó, általános margó

- Mint már mondtam, képek, amelyek szintén tiszteletben tartják a dokumentumra vonatkozó margókat

- Tartalomjegyzék, amely tartalmazza a már fent említett fejezeteket. Bónusz pont ha kattintásra a fejezethez is ugrik, nem kötelező

- És mindez legyen minimum 10 oldalas, hogy jól látható legyen a követelmények megfelelő teljesítése.


Ezt nevezem én egy 'szokványos' dokumentumnak. És mint már mondtam, lehetőleg kevesebb mint 1 óra alatt. Ezt a gyerekfirkát meg szerintem dugd el mélyen a fiókba.

2020. nov. 12. 18:14
Hasznos számodra ez a válasz?
 12/43 anonim ***** válasza:
Oh, majd elfelejtettem: A feladat megoldásához nem használhatsz SEMMILYEN előre megírt kódot. Nem, azt a csoda kódot sem, amit te magad n+1 évvel ezelőtt megírtál magadnak erre a célra. Elvégre az egész mondandód arra épült, hogy bárminemű kész kód felhasználása nélkül is könnyen megugorható feladatról van szó.
2020. nov. 12. 18:16
Hasznos számodra ez a válasz?
 13/43 anonim ***** válasza:
Mi értelme van ennek pontosan? Mindkettőtöktől kérdezem. Mit akartok bizonyítani?
2020. nov. 12. 20:02
Hasznos számodra ez a válasz?
 14/43 anonim ***** válasza:
#13 Ő szeret badarságokat hordani, és mindenkibe belekötni, én pedig szeretem a képébe dörgölni, hogy egy inkompetens balfék. Nagyjából ennyi.
2020. nov. 12. 20:23
Hasznos számodra ez a válasz?
 15/43 anonim ***** válasza:

13: Ő tett egy nyilatkozatot, mi szerint ez a pdf generálás egy elég nehéz dolog, mert hát, a nyelv leírása is ezer oldal.


Valójában a pdf formátum egy hrtml-hez hasonló oldalleíró nyelvre épül. Az aló igaz, hogy 1000 oldalas a leírás, legalábbis az utóbbi, ami asszem az 1.7-es, de ebben helyet kap nagyon sok olyan dolog, amit az átlagember nem használ.

Ilyenek a beágyazott fontok, a klf. multimédiás lehetőségek, úrlapok, miegyebek.


Valójában egy pdf dokumentumot nem nehéz létrehozni. Meg kell ismerni a pdf fájlok szerkezetét, majd az alapvető opciókat és azok plain text formában kiírhatók a dokumentum tartalmával együtt. Ami nehézséget okozhat egy kezdőnek, az egyedül a compressed forma, vagy az extrémebb igények, a nagyon összetett tartalmi megjelenítés. Viszont, a fickó által soroltak egyike sem ilyen. Margin, header vagy footer, page numbering, creator's name, date, stb. Ezek nevetségesen egyszerű dolgok.

2020. nov. 12. 20:28
Hasznos számodra ez a válasz?
 16/43 anonim ***** válasza:
#15 Én nem tettem ilyen állítást, te ragaszkodtál hozzá, hogy ehhez fölösleges előre megírt könyvtárat használni, mert lám milyen egyszerű összerakni nulláról. Ez az állítás önmagában elég a szegénységi bizonyítványra, de gondoltam próbára teszem, hogy menynire is tudja hatékonyan kamatoztatni a tudását. Mint az kiderült, egyáltalán nem.
2020. nov. 12. 20:43
Hasznos számodra ez a válasz?
 17/43 anonim ***** válasza:

Ezt te írtad:


"#2: Azért azt nem mondanám, hogy könnyű. Adobe oldalán fent van a szabványról a dokumentum. 1000 oldal."


A könnyű ellentéte a nehéz.

Tudatlan, kötekedő, abszolút amatőr ember vagy, aki azt hiszi, hogy ami neki nem megy az másnak sem.

2020. nov. 12. 20:51
Hasznos számodra ez a válasz?
 18/43 anonim ***** válasza:
Nem, ezt nem én írtam.
2020. nov. 12. 21:38
Hasznos számodra ez a válasz?
 19/43 anonim ***** válasza:

"#2: Azért azt nem mondanám, hogy könnyű. Adobe oldalán fent van a szabványról a dokumentum. 1000 oldal."


Ez én voltam, de olyan szépen sikerült bemutatkoznod a válaszoddal, hogy itt is hagytalak. A többieknek is ezt javaslom. Egy ilyen ember nem alkalmas arra, hogy értelmes vitát lehessen folytatni vele.

2020. nov. 12. 23:52
Hasznos számodra ez a válasz?
 20/43 anonim ***** válasza:
0%

"de olyan szépen sikerült bemutatkoznod a válaszoddal,"


Neked sikerült olyan szépen megvillantanod a képességeidet, illetve, azok hiányát, hogy tényleg nem tudom, egyáltalán, mit is keresel itt? Hacsak nem olvasgatni, tanulgatni akarsz. Mert többre amúgysem vagy képes.

Neked is írom, meg a másik követelőző, amúgy dupla nulla kreténnek is, ne képzeljétek, hogy ide csak hozzátok hasonló, olyan fű-zöldek járnak, akik számára megoldhatatlan feladat némi formázott szöveg pdf fájlba foglalása és mások által írt libraryk nélkül még vizelni sem képesek.

2020. nov. 13. 00:37
Hasznos számodra ez a válasz?
1 2 3 4 5

Kapcsolódó kérdések:




Minden jog fenntartva © 2025,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u

A weboldalon megjelenő anyagok nem minősülnek szerkesztői tartalomnak, előzetes ellenőrzésen nem esnek át, az üzemeltető véleményét nem tükrözik.
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!